The artistic influence of the period: L'art Nouveau

By precaution, it is important to mention that not all posters are influenced by the main artistic movement of the period they belong to. Some are inspired by the unique style of the artist, by another art movement, or simply refuse conformism

Art Nouveau is a style of visual arts and architecture that developed in both Europe and North America at the end of the 19TH century. It employs many plant motifs and is characterized by flowing, curvilinear forms. Art Nouveau pieces are highly ornamental and generally are asymmetrical.

It is thought that this Art Period arose in response to the Industrial Revolution. It appears to deplore the shoddiness of mass produced, machine-made objects. Standards of grace and beauty were applied to everyday goods. The Art Nouveau movement was extremely broad in scope. Its principles were applied to building design as well as to all items within the building. Art Nouveau broke the barriers between fine and applied arts. No object was over-looked no matter how utilitarian. The magnificent wrought iron entrances to the Metro in Paris, designed by Hector Guimard are classic example of the Art Nouveau style.
